Ordinals
beta
Address 1HD6cg57gj1PbaMaGmBhgauyMJhaQ8TUiD
sat balance
647843
outputs
c88e97eee4ca708cc55be3760cb1cb1fd1f6a73592ce6b21f4b347c632ab6f04:82